Here are the essential techniques, tools, and expert insights that will help you draw windows like a pro and achieve both aesthetic and practical success.Tips 1: Know and Apply Standard Window SymbolsIn architectural drafting, windows are universally shown as two thin parallel lines (representing glass) within a break in the wall outline. This symbol must be used consistently—ambiguity here can result in miscommunication with contractors and even failed inspection for code compliance. For context, the American Institute of Architects (AIA) provides standardized symbols—see the AIA Architectural Graphic Standards for reference. Don’t forget: clarity on your plan equals fewer delays in the field.Tips 2: Precise Measurement and Strategic PlacementBefore marking a window, always confirm your floor plan’s scale, for example, 1/4" = 1'-0". Using a scale ruler or digital tool, measure the actual width of the intended window (e.g., 4 feet), convert that to plan dimensions, and mark the exact starting and ending points on the wall. Pro tip: window height matters too—especially for meeting egress or light-to-floor-area code (consult the U.S. Department of Housing and Urban Development’s window egress guidelines).Arrange windows for optimal daylight and symmetry. For ADA accessibility or LEED certification targeting, window positions must sometimes follow stricter criteria—review regional regulations early in the process for compliance.Tips 3: Finalizing and Annotating Your Window DetailsOnce window positions are confirmed, add the symbol (two parallel lines in the wall gap) and label each window with dimensions (W for width, H for height). For unique units (arched, bay, or custom-glazed windows), supplement with a key or legend. Advanced digital floor planners let you customize window symbols, include swing indications for operable windows (shown as arcs or dashed lines), and export plans for contractor or regulatory review.Don’t overlook notation for window types (e.g., FX for fixed, AW for awning, etc.)—these details speed up construction and ordering. To explore and compare various window placements, use tools like the drag-and-drop room planner for instant visual feedback.Tips 4: Integrate Real-World Context and Design Best PracticesExpert interior designers factor in light direction and seasonal shading when placing windows, not just aesthetics. For example, larger windows on the south face (in northern hemisphere homes) maximize passive solar gain. Conversely, smaller or shaded windows in the west help prevent late-day overheating—principles outlined in the U.S. Department of Energy’s window design guide. When documenting your plan, note the exterior orientation for each window and consider integrating real climate data for higher-performing, more comfortable spaces.Additionally, review manufacturer specifications for frame thickness, operability, and minimum clearances. For regulatory projects or client handoffs, export to industry-standard file formats like PDF, DWG, or IFC.FAQQ: What symbol represents a window on architectural floor plans? A: Standard window symbols are breaks in the wall (solid) line with two thin parallel lines or a thin rectangle, indicating the glass pane. Refer to the AIA’s official graphic standards for nuanced variations.Q: How do I calculate window size on a scaled drawing? A: Measure the window’s intended real-world width, apply your plan’s scale factor, and replicate that measurement precisely on the drawing (e.g., 4’ actual width at 1/4”=1’ would be 1 inch on the plan).Q: Can I show window opening direction and type? A: Yes—use a thin arc or dashed line to indicate the swing direction for casements and awnings. Type annotations (FX, SH, SL) clarify design intent for contractors and suppliers.Q: Are there U.S. codes for minimum window sizes or placements? A: Absolutely. Egress windows in sleeping areas must meet minimum size/height per the International Residential Code (IRC) and local building offices, with details available at ICC’s residential code resources.Q: What digital tools streamline the window-drawing process?
